As an engineering student, I spend my days doing tons of math and physics. I constantly have to draw graphs, and I got tired of sloppy, ugly graphs. So I made the Graphing Tool, which is a straight edge on one side and a notched edge on the other. The notched edge is for making the ticks on a graph, which I spaced out to perfectly line up with college-lined papers. There are 11 ticks, so it is perfect for a 10*10 graph, although you can make any size graph you want by leap-frogging (for a lack of a better term) the tool to extend the length. Additionally, there is a peephole so you can line up the tool perpendicular to another line, and a 5mm hole to fit a binder ring.
